  • How to make students don't see the Veyon window

    2
    0 Votes
    2 Posts
    347 Views
    G
    Presumably your projector is just duplicating your current monitor, correct? Set your projector to EXTEND your desktop rather than duplicate. Then you can show whatever you need to on the projector "monitor" and keep things you do not want students to see on your actual monitor on your desk.

  • VEYON 4.5.0.0 with DHCP

    2
    0 Votes
    2 Posts
    593 Views
    E
    Veyon depends heavily on static addresses. There are options to make use of some weird techiques to make it work with dynamic addreses, not worth the headache though. Static is definitely the main solution.
